A woman died from a tire falling off a truck in Mytishchi
In Mytishchi, Moscow region, a 32-year-old woman died as a result of a truck wheel disconnection. This was reported on October 2 in the press service of the Inter-Municipal Department of the Ministry of Internal Affairs of Russia "Mytischinskoe".
"A truck driven by a 50-year-old driver had its rear left wheels disconnected due to a technical malfunction, as a result of which one of them continued its spontaneous movement due to inertia," the department's Telegram channel said.
It is noted that the incident occurred on October 1 on the 19th km of the M-8 Kholmogory highway. A 32-year-old woman was at the bus shelter when a loose tire hit her. As a result of the accident, she died on the spot.
